** 3 thành phần chính của blockchain **

Blockchain là một cơ sở dữ liệu phân tán được sử dụng để duy trì danh sách các hồ sơ phát triển liên tục, được gọi là các khối.Mỗi khối chứa một hàm băm mật mã của khối trước, dấu thời gian và dữ liệu giao dịch.Blockchains thường được quản lý bởi một mạng ngang hàng để tuân thủ một giao thức để giao tiếp giữa các nút và xác thực các khối mới.Sau khi được ghi lại, dữ liệu trong bất kỳ khối nào cũng không thể thay đổi hồi tố mà không thay đổi tất cả các khối tiếp theo, đòi hỏi sự thông đồng của đa số mạng.

### 1. ** sổ cái phân tán **

Sổ cái phân tán là một thành phần chính của công nghệ blockchain.Đây là một cơ sở dữ liệu được chia sẻ giữa các nút của mạng và nó được cập nhật và duy trì bởi tất cả các nút.Điều này có nghĩa là không có điểm thất bại duy nhất và dữ liệu trong sổ cái không bị giả mạo.

### 2. ** Cryptography **

Cryptography là một thành phần thiết yếu khác của công nghệ blockchain.Nó được sử dụng để bảo mật dữ liệu trong sổ cái và để xác minh tính xác thực của các khối mới.Cryptography được sử dụng để tạo ra một chữ ký kỹ thuật số cho mỗi khối, được sử dụng để xác minh rằng khối chưa bị giả mạo.

### 3. ** Cơ chế đồng thuận **

Cơ chế đồng thuận là một cách để đảm bảo rằng tất cả các nút trong mạng đồng ý về thứ tự của các khối trong sổ cái.Điều này là cần thiết để ngăn chặn chi tiêu gấp đôi và các cuộc tấn công khác vào blockchain.Có một số cơ chế đồng thuận khác nhau có thể được sử dụng, chẳng hạn như bằng chứng công việc, bằng chứng cổ phần và bằng chứng ủy quyền của cổ phần.

**3 Main Components of Blockchain**

Blockchain is a distributed database that is used to maintain a continuously growing list of records, called blocks. Each block contains a cryptographic hash of the previous block, a timestamp, and transaction data. Blockchains are typically managed by a peer-to-peer network collectively adhering to a protocol for inter-node communication and validating new blocks. Once recorded, the data in any given block cannot be altered retroactively without the alteration of all subsequent blocks, which requires collusion of the network majority.

### 1. **Distributed Ledger**

The distributed ledger is a key component of blockchain technology. It is a database that is shared among the nodes of a network, and it is updated and maintained by all of the nodes. This means that there is no single point of failure, and that the data in the ledger is tamper-proof.

### 2. **Cryptography**

Cryptography is another essential component of blockchain technology. It is used to secure the data in the ledger and to verify the authenticity of new blocks. Cryptography is used to create a digital signature for each block, which is used to verify that the block has not been tampered with.

### 3. **Consensus Mechanism**

The consensus mechanism is a way to ensure that all of the nodes in the network agree on the order of the blocks in the ledger. This is necessary to prevent double-spending and other attacks on the blockchain. There are a number of different consensus mechanisms that can be used, such as Proof of Work, Proof of Stake, and Delegated Proof of Stake.


